CentOS7 Docker配置国内镜像源教程

版权申诉
0 下载量 173 浏览量 更新于2024-08-08 收藏 657KB DOCX 举报
"CentOS7-Docker配置国内镜像源" 在Docker的使用过程中,为了提高镜像下载速度,通常需要配置国内的镜像源。由于网络限制,直接使用Docker官方仓库可能会非常慢,因此,我们可以选择使用国内的服务提供商如阿里云、网易、中科大或DaoCloud等提供的镜像加速服务。以下是如何在CentOS7系统上配置这些镜像源的步骤: 1. Docker中国官方镜像加速: 在`daemon.json`文件中添加以下内容: ```json { "registry-mirrors": ["https://registry.docker-cn.com"] } ``` 这将使Docker使用Docker中国的镜像源。 2. 网易163镜像加速: 可以使用以下配置: ```json { "registry-mirrors": ["http://hub-mirror.c.163.com"] } ``` 网易163提供了镜像加速服务,可以显著提升下载速度。 3. 中科大镜像加速: 中科大的镜像源配置如下: ```json { "registry-mirrors": ["https://docker.mirrors.ustc.edu.cn"] } ``` 4. 阿里云镜像加速: 首先需要在阿里云官方网站注册账号并登录,然后进入容器镜像服务控制台(或直接访问 https://cr.console.aliyun.com/#/accelerator),获取你的专属加速地址。例如,加速地址可能是 `https://og7vpkky.mirror.aliyuncs.com`,将这个地址添加到`daemon.json`中。 5. DaoCloud镜像加速: 同样,需要在DaoCloud官方网站注册并登录,然后选择加速器服务,获取个人的加速地址。这个地址将类似于 `http://{your_id}.m.daocloud.io`,替换 `{your_id}` 为实际获取的ID。 配置Docker镜像源的步骤如下: 1. 创建Docker配置文件夹: ```bash sudo mkdir -p /etc/docker ``` 2. 编辑`daemon.json`文件: ```bash sudo vi /etc/docker/daemon.json ``` 在打开的文件中,输入相应的镜像源配置,例如阿里云的配置。 3. 保存并关闭文件后,重启Docker服务以应用新的配置: ```bash sudo systemctl restart docker ``` 通过上述操作,Docker将在启动时使用配置的国内镜像源,从而提高下载镜像的速度。请注意,每次更换镜像源时都需要更新`daemon.json`文件,并重启Docker服务。同时,某些镜像加速服务可能需要用户注册并获取个性化的加速地址,所以务必按照服务商提供的指南进行操作。